A significant strategy for cultivating inclusivity is to tailor outreach programs to meet the diverse needs and backgrounds of community members. This involves conducting thorough assessments to understand the specific challenges and resources within the community. Collaborating closely with community leaders, stakeholders, and members themselves allows us to design programs that truly reflect and cater to the multifaceted nature of the community it seeks to serve. For instance, developing language accessibility through translation services can open doors to newcomers who may feel isolated by language barriers. Similarly, offering childcare during events allows parents to engage without burdening themselves with additional responsibilities. Creating welcoming environments also involves training and equipping volunteers to embrace cultural competence and sensitivity, ensuring interactions are respectful and understanding.
